本文目录导读:
随着大数据时代的到来,Hadoop作为一款分布式计算框架,被广泛应用于企业级大数据处理中,Hadoop集群的部署方式主要有物理机部署和虚拟化部署两种,本文将从两者的优劣势入手,分析不同场景下的适用性,并给出相应的选择建议。
物理机部署
1、优势
(1)性能稳定:物理机部署的Hadoop集群具有更高的性能稳定性,因为物理机不受虚拟化技术的影响,能够充分发挥硬件性能。
(2)资源利用率高:物理机部署的Hadoop集群资源利用率较高,无需为虚拟化技术分配额外资源。
图片来源于网络,如有侵权联系删除
(3)安全性高:物理机部署的Hadoop集群安全性较高,不易受到虚拟化环境中的安全漏洞影响。
(4)易于扩展:物理机部署的Hadoop集群在扩展时,只需增加物理服务器即可,无需修改虚拟化环境。
2、劣势
(1)成本较高:物理机部署需要购买大量服务器,初期投资成本较高。
(2)维护难度大:物理机部署的Hadoop集群维护难度较大,需要专业人员进行硬件维护。
(3)扩展性有限:物理机部署的Hadoop集群在扩展时,受限于物理服务器数量。
虚拟化部署
1、优势
图片来源于网络,如有侵权联系删除
(1)成本较低:虚拟化部署可以利用现有服务器资源,降低初期投资成本。
(2)易于扩展:虚拟化部署可以根据需求动态调整资源,实现快速扩展。
(3)维护方便:虚拟化部署的Hadoop集群维护较为简单,只需关注虚拟化环境即可。
(4)安全性高:虚拟化部署的Hadoop集群安全性较高,可利用虚拟化技术实现隔离。
2、劣势
(1)性能损耗:虚拟化部署的Hadoop集群在性能上会有一定损耗,因为虚拟化技术会占用部分CPU、内存等资源。
(2)资源利用率低:虚拟化部署的Hadoop集群资源利用率较低,部分资源会被虚拟化技术占用。
图片来源于网络,如有侵权联系删除
(3)安全性风险:虚拟化部署的Hadoop集群存在一定的安全风险,如虚拟机逃逸等。
选择建议
1、从成本角度考虑:如果企业预算充足,可以选择物理机部署;如果预算有限,可以考虑虚拟化部署。
2、从性能需求考虑:如果对性能要求较高,应选择物理机部署;如果性能需求一般,可以考虑虚拟化部署。
3、从扩展性考虑:如果企业对扩展性要求较高,应选择虚拟化部署;如果扩展性需求一般,可以选择物理机部署。
4、从维护难度考虑:如果企业对维护难度要求较高,应选择物理机部署;如果维护难度要求一般,可以考虑虚拟化部署。
Hadoop集群的部署方式应结合企业实际情况进行选择,在保证性能、安全、稳定的前提下,合理选择物理机部署或虚拟化部署,以实现成本、效率、可扩展性的平衡。
标签: #hadoop 物理机还是虚拟化部署
评论列表